YOUNGSTOWN, Ohio -
 
An anti-abortion group plans to show graphic abortion videos on a JumboTron on YSU's campus.
 
The group, Created Equal, said in a press release that the videos depict "the gruesome reality of abortion," and they say their goal is to engage students in conversation.
 
The group says that due to recent events, including the enforcement of Texas' Heartbeat Law and the upcoming Supreme Court decision on Dobbs v. Jackson Women's Health Organization, they have seen an increase in the number of protestors at their outreaches.
 
They claim police have taken down their signs, and protestors have stolen and vandalized their signs.
 
The organization will be on YSU's campus Thursday, March 17th. The display will be set up near DeBartolo Hall from 10 a.m.- 2 p.m.
 
The group says the project is an attempt to influence America's future decision-makers and leaders.
